Navigating the World of Online Casino Bonuses

One of the key draws for many players is the availability of bonuses and promotions offered by online casinos. These can range from welcome bonuses for new players to ongoing rewards for loyal customers. However,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with these offers, as they often come with wagering requirements. Wagering requirements dictate the amount of money a player needs to bet before they can withdraw any winnings derived from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means a player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before being eligible for a withdrawal. Ignoring these conditions can lead to frustration and difficulty in accessing your funds.

Different types of bonuses cater to different play styles. Deposit bonuses require a player to deposit funds into their account to receive the bonus, while no-deposit bonuses offer a small amount of credit simply for signing up. Free spins are another popular type of bonus, allowing players to spin the reels of a slot game without using their own funds. It’s often beneficial to compare bonus offers across different casinos to find the one that best suits your preferences and risk tolerance. Always read the fine print – hidden terms can significantly impact the value of a bonus.

The Importance of Responsible Gambling

While online casinos offer entertainment and potential rewards, it’s essential to approach them responsibly. Gambling can be addictive, and it’s important to be aware of the risks involved. Setting limits on your spending and time spent gambling is a crucial step in maintaining control. Many online casinos offer tools to help players manage their gambling habits,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. A deposit limit restricts the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period, while a loss limit caps the amount you can lose within a defined timeframe.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from accessing the casino’s services.

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is equally important. These can include chasing losses, gambling with money you can’t afford to lose, lying about your gambling habits, and neglecting personal respon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, help is available. Organizations like GamCare and BeGambleAware offer confidential support and guidance. Don't hesitate to reach out – se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.

Payment Methods and Security Features

A secure and reliable payment system is fundamental to any online casino experience. Reputable platforms offer a variety of payment methods to cater to different preferences,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ets like PayPal and Skrill, and bank transfers. Each method has its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of speed, fees, and security. E-wallets are often favored for their added layer of security, as they act as a buffer between your bank account and the casino. However, some casinos may not accept all e-wallets, so it’s important to check the available options before signing up.

Security is paramount when it comes to online gambling. Casinos should employ robust enc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ock icon in your browser’s address bar, indicating a secure connection. Furthermore, reputable casinos undergo regular audits by independent testing agencies to ensure fairness and transparency. These audits verify that the casino’s games are random and that payouts are accurate. Verifying license details on the UKGC website is also a critical step in confirming a casino's legitimacy.

The Evolution of Live Dealer Games

Live dealer games represent a significant advancement in the online casino experience. They bridge the gap between the convenience of online gambling and the immersive atmosphere of a brick-and-mortar casino. These games feature a real human dealer who interacts with players in real-time through a live video stream.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ker. The ability to interact with the dealer and other players adds a social element to the experience, making it more engaging and realistic.

The technology behind live dealer games has improved dramatically in recent years, with high-definition video streams and sophisticated software creating a seamless and immersive experience. Players can often choose from multiple camera angles and adjust the video quality to suit their preferences. Some live dealer games also incorporate innovative features, such as side bets and interactive chat options.
